About this program

The Bachelor’s degree in Environmental Science and Studies at Towson University is a comprehensive program that explores the intricate relationships between humans and the environment. The curriculum covers core scientific principles, interdisciplinary approaches, and real-world applications, enabling students to understand and address environmental issues on local, national, and global scales. Key subjects include ecosystem dynamics, environmental policies, conservation, and sustainable development, complemented by hands-on experiences in laboratories and fieldwork.

Students engage in a variety of coursework focusing on environmental science, sociology, economics, and policy-making. Typical structures involve foundational courses in biology, chemistry, and geology, followed by specialized electives and capstone projects that encourage critical thinking and problem-solving. This ensures that graduates are not only knowledgeable but also equipped with the skills needed to meet the challenges of environmental management.

By pursuing a degree in this field at Towson University, students benefit from the institution's focus on sustainability and its commitment to preparing students for timely environmental issues. The proximity to diverse ecosystems provides ample opportunities for field studies, research projects, and engagement with local communities, enhancing students' educational experience.

The program also emphasizes the development of technical skills, data analysis, and effective communication, crucial for any career in environmental sectors. Graduating from this program empowers students to advocate for sustainable practices and contribute positively to environmental conservation efforts.

Entry requirements

To be considered for the Bachelor’s degree in Environmental Science and Studies at Towson University, applicants are generally expected to meet the following academic prerequisites:

  • A high school diploma or equivalent
  • Completion of specific high school courses in science (biology, chemistry) and mathematics (algebra, geometry)
  • A strong GPA that meets university standards and reflects potential for success in a science-focused program
English:

International students must demonstrate proficiency in the English language. Typically, a minimum IELTS score of 6.5 or a TOEFL score of 79 is required, indicating competency in academic English to succeed in university-level coursework.
